So my laptop is old. I know. Laugh if you want.
I have a 600 mhz Power PC G3. I have upgraded my OS a while back. I have OS 10.4.11. I primarily use the machine to surf the Web, update my little blog and maybe listen to some music. Well, I plugged some USB speakers in a few months back and they didn't work. This was probably in December 2007. I figured it was the speakers. They were cheap. I don't usually need speakers, on board is enough. Well, I wanted to use some in October and I got out my USB speakers. This is a different set. They are powered. No sound. I tried again this weekend with yet a third set, no luck. Yes, I did the System Preferences, audio, USB speakers. They speakers show up, they light up, there is just no sound. If I unplug them, I have sound through the onboard speakers immediately. Someone suggested this was a problem with OS compatibility and my older machine. Well, I'm not incredibly technical so I'm not sure how to go back to an older version of the os. I'm not even sure that would solve my problem. ANY SUGGESTIONS!
